#d1c75f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d1c75f is composed of 82% red, 78% green and 37.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 4.8% magenta, 54.5% yellow and 18% black. It has a hue angle of 54.7 degrees, a saturation of 55.3% and a lightness of 59.6%. #d1c75f color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ffbe with #a38f00. Closest websafe color is: #cccc66.

#d1c75f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d1c75f has RGB values of R:209, G:199, B:95 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.05, Y:0.55, K:0.18. Its decimal value is 13748063.
